My server Amanda was amazing. She is the friendliest and sweetest server I've ever had. She got our order right without writing anything down, refilled our drinks without us having to ask and was very professional and warm. Will definitely be going back and hopefully will have the same server!

My husband and I went to the Newport Diner for dinner tonight. Amanda our server was friendly and attentive. My husband ordered the roasted turkey dinner and was surprised of the thick cuts of turkey (white and dark meat), homemade stuffing and mashed potatoes-- this is his "go to favorite dinner". He loved it he said that it was VERY GOOD. I had the Big Hearty breakfast with a side of scrapple, also very good. The hash browns were cooked perfectly. The place is clean and you can see into the kitchen which is also very clean. We will be back. Thank you

Afer shopping at Costco and reading the reviews, we decided to give this place a try. We were immediately seated after arriving. The restaurant is small, but very spacious and not at all cramped. It's very minimally decorated, with the walls being light gray and adorned with blind-covered windows. A Christmas tree stands next to the entrance while counter seating can be found by the entrance to the kitchen. All of the seats sans the counter are booth seats, with some of the booths having regular chairs as well. Hubs ordered the fried oysters platter from the weekly specials. He said that he should've ordered with his head Instead of his heart. He recognized that hr should've ordered it at a seafood joint. It was passable and felt something was missing and can't be pinpointed. I thought it was fried okay but it tasted bland. He also ordered potato salad and thought it was ok. Daughter ordered 2 eggs over easy with scrapple. She loved the scrapple and said she will definitely order this again next time! Lastly, I ordered short stack banana pancakes, which is 2 pancakes versus 3 pancakes for a hot stack. It was pretty good and fluffy. Service was pretty friendly and quick. This place is located in a strip mall and there's no fear of not finding a parking spot. Will definitely return when in the area to try other items on the menu.
